Friend, Nebraska

Friend, Nebraska, in Saline county, is 34 miles W of Lincoln, Nebraska (center to center) and 81 miles SW of Omaha, Nebraska. The city is home to some 1,174 residents.

Wealth and Education

In 2000, Friend had a median family income of $40,667.

Friend Housing

According to the 2000 census, 79% of the housing in Friend was owner-occupied. You may be likely to find historic buildings in the city as the average housing age is high.

Commuting

In Friend, 91% of commuters drive to work. Unlike a lot of places, in Friend it is actually possible for many people to ride their bikes to work, or even walk.

Alcohol Rehab or Drug Rehabilitation Centers in Friend have a two-prong approach to treatment, both the physical and psychological causes and effects of drug and alcohol addiction. As the individual's brain adapts to the use of a psychoactive substance over time, the effect that the drug creates within the body is lessened. Due to this physical tolerance, more and more drugs or alcohol must be consumed to get high or even get a buzz.

The physical aspect of addiction is the first thing an addict will address when making the decision to seek treatment for addiction. A detoxification program in Friend, Nebraska delivered by a qualified Drug Rehab or Alcohol Rehabilitation Facility will navigate the addict through the uncomfortable withdrawal symptoms that are caused by abruptly coming off of drugs or alcohol. These withdrawal symptoms can last for days, weeks or months; all depending on the drug of choice and individual circumstances. Heroin withdrawal for example will take a considerable amount of time to detox and is a highly painful and uncomfortable process.
